解压神器:批处理解压文件命令的妙用
解压神器:批处理解压文件命令的妙用
在日常工作和学习中,我们经常需要处理大量的压缩文件。手动解压不仅耗时,而且容易出错。今天,我们就来探讨一下批处理解压文件命令,这是一个可以大大提高工作效率的工具。
什么是批处理解压文件命令?
批处理解压文件命令是指通过编写批处理脚本(Batch Script)来自动化解压缩文件的过程。批处理脚本是一种简单的文本文件,包含一系列命令行指令,可以在Windows操作系统中执行。这些命令可以自动化重复的任务,比如解压多个压缩文件。
为什么需要批处理解压文件命令?
-
提高效率:手动解压文件不仅耗时,而且容易出错。批处理可以一次性处理多个文件,节省大量时间。
-
自动化操作:对于需要定期处理大量压缩文件的场景,批处理可以自动化整个过程,减少人工干预。
-
一致性:批处理脚本可以确保每次解压的操作都是一致的,避免因人为操作不同而导致的问题。
常用的批处理解压文件命令
以下是一些常用的批处理解压文件命令:
-
WinRAR:WinRAR是一个非常流行的压缩工具,其命令行版本可以用于批处理解压。例如:
@echo off for %%f in (*.rar) do ( "C:\Program Files\WinRAR\WinRAR.exe" x "%%f" "解压目录\" )
-
7-Zip:7-Zip是一个免费的开源压缩工具,支持多种压缩格式。它的命令行工具
7z.exe
可以这样使用:@echo off for %%f in (*.zip) do ( "C:\Program Files\7-Zip\7z.exe" x "%%f" -o"解压目录\" )
-
内置命令:Windows自带的
expand
命令可以解压.cab
文件:@echo off for %%f in (*.cab) do ( expand "%%f" -F:* "解压目录\" )
批处理解压文件命令的应用场景
-
数据备份与恢复:在数据备份和恢复过程中,批处理可以自动解压备份文件,简化操作。
-
软件分发:软件开发人员可以使用批处理脚本自动解压软件包,方便用户安装。
-
数据处理:对于需要处理大量数据的场景,如数据分析、日志分析等,批处理可以自动解压数据文件。
-
自动化测试:在软件测试中,批处理可以自动解压测试用例文件,提高测试效率。
注意事项
- 安全性:确保脚本中的路径和命令是安全的,避免执行未经授权的操作。
- 兼容性:不同版本的压缩工具可能有不同的命令行参数,确保脚本的兼容性。
- 错误处理:在脚本中加入错误处理机制,确保在解压过程中出现问题时能够及时反馈。
总结
批处理解压文件命令是提高工作效率的利器。通过编写简单的脚本,我们可以自动化处理大量压缩文件,减少人工操作的繁琐和错误。无论是数据备份、软件分发还是数据处理,批处理都能发挥其独特的优势。希望本文能帮助大家更好地理解和应用批处理解压文件命令,提升工作效率。